Power That Defines a Generation

At the heart of this classic is a 427 cubic inch V8 engine that generates a robust 390 horsepower. This isn’t just about numbers; it’s about the sensation of raw power under your control. The automatic transmission ensures smooth shifting, while the rear-wheel drive layout provides the kind of thrilling performance that has made Corvettes legendary.
